How It Helps You Get Safer and Better Dental Treatment


If you’ve ever had a filling or a root canal, you may have noticed your dentist placing a small sheet over your mouth, leaving only the tooth being worked on exposed. This is called a rubber dam, and while it may look unusual at first, it’s an essential part of modern dental care.

Think of it as a protective shield that makes your treatment safer, cleaner, and more comfortable.

What is a Rubber Dam?


A rubber dam is a soft, flexible sheet (made of latex or non-latex material) that isolates the tooth your dentist is treating. It’s held in place with a small clip and frame, so only the tooth being worked on is visible.


Why is a Rubber Dam Important?


1. Keeps the Area Dry

Many dental materials, such as fillings and bonding agents, don’t work well if they come into contact with saliva. The rubber dam keeps the tooth dry so your treatment lasts longer.


2. Makes Treatments Safer

It prevents small instruments, water, or dental materials from accidentally slipping into your mouth or throat, so you don’t have to worry about swallowing or inhaling anything during treatment.


3. More Comfortable for You

With the dam in place, you won’t taste dental materials, and it keeps your tongue and cheeks out of the way. Many patients find this actually makes the procedure more comfortable.


4. Essential for Root Canal Treatments

When treating the inside of a tooth, a clean and bacteria-free environment is crucial. The rubber dam helps protect your tooth from saliva, reducing the chance of infection and improving long-term success.


5. Helps the Dentist Work Better

By isolating just the tooth being treated, your dentist has a clearer view and better access. This means the procedure is usually quicker, more precise, and more effective.


Benefits of the Rubber Dam

 For You (the Patient):

  • A safer treatment with less risk of swallowing instruments.
  • A more comfortable experience.
  • Stronger, longer-lasting fillings and root canal results.
  • Protection against infection.


 For the Dentist:

  • Clear visibility and better working conditions.
  • Easier, faster, and more accurate treatment.
  • Higher quality results.

While it may initially feel strange, the rubber dam makes your dental visit safer, more comfortable, and more effective. It’s a small step that makes a big difference in ensuring you get the best possible care.
